Sending contacts

You can send contacts using one of the available
transfer methods.
To send a contact
} Contacts
and select a contact
} Send contact
and select a transfer method.
To send all contacts
} Contacts } Options } Advanced
} Send all contacts
and select a transfer method.

Copying contacts

You can copy names and numbers to and from your
phone contacts and the SIM card. Choose if you
want to copy all numbers, or a single number.
When you select to copy all contacts from the phone to
the SIM card, all existing information on the SIM card
will be replaced.

Call list
The numbers of the most recent calls are saved
in the call list. Dialled, answered and missed calls
are listed under separate tabs.
